Bollywood star Alia Bhatt, one of the industry’s most celebrated actors, has officially adopted her husband Ranbir Kapoor’s surname, now going by Alia Bhatt Kapoor. This addition marks a significant personal milestone for Alia, symbolizing the evolution of her journey since marrying into the renowned Kapoor family, one of Bollywood’s most prominent film dynasties. Alia’s fans first noticed the change during the trailer of The Great Indian Kapil Show Season 2, where she was introduced with her new name, “Alia Bhatt Kapoor.” The revelation, which immediately caught the attention of fans and media alike, has sparked a flurry of discussion surrounding her decision to embrace this new identity.
Alia’s new chapter as Alia Bhatt Kapoor coincides with the much-anticipated release of her upcoming film, Jigra, directed by Vasan Bala. The Kapoor Legacy: A Bollywood Dynasty
To understand the significance of Alia’s new name, it’s essential to appreciate the Kapoor family’s contribution to Indian cinema. The Kapoor dynasty, often regarded as Bollywood royalty, has been an integral part of the Indian film industry for generations. It all started with Prithviraj Kapoor, one of the pioneers of Indian cinema, followed by his son Raj Kapoor, who became one of the most revered actors and filmmakers in Bollywood. The Kapoor lineage continued with Rishi Kapoor, Randhir Kapoor, and their respective families, with the current generation represented by Ranbir Kapoor.
For decades, the Kapoor family has produced some of the biggest names in Indian cinema, making the Kapoor surname synonymous with artistic excellence, box-office success, and timeless legacy. Alia Bhatt, by adding “Kapoor” to her name, now carries forward this rich legacy, aligning herself with a family that has been instrumental in shaping Bollywood’s history. Alia Bhatt: A Star in Her Own Right
While her new name may have deep personal significance, Alia Bhatt’s career is a testament to her incredible talent and hard work. Since her debut in Student of the Year in 2012, Alia has risen to the top of the Bollywood hierarchy, cementing herself as one of the industry’s most versatile and sought-after actresses. Over the years, Alia has delivered exceptional performances in critically acclaimed films like Raazi, Gully Boy, Highway, and Gangubai Kathiawadi. Her ability to embody a wide range of characters with depth and authenticity has earned her numerous awards and accolades.
What makes Alia’s journey so remarkable is that she built her own identity and carved out her place in the industry, despite being born into the Bhatt family, another well-known Bollywood household. Her father, filmmaker Mahesh Bhatt, and mother, actress Soni Razdan, have been influential figures in Bollywood, but Alia’s success has been driven by her talent and dedication to her craft.
